  1. 1. Numerical Simulation of High Reynolds Number Wall Bounded Flow

    Author : Tobias Persson; Chalmers tekniska högskola;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; subgrid model; DES; high; validation; LES; numerical simulation; near-wall;

    Abstract : In this thesis, four different numerical methods are used for predictions of high Reynoldsnumber (Re), wall bounded flows; Large Eddy Simulation (LES) with two different subgrid(turbulence) models, the One Equation Eddy Viscosity model (OEEVM) and the MixedModel (MM), Monotone Integrated LES (MILES), Detached Eddy Simulation (DES) andReynolds Averaged Navier Stokes (RANS). The LES calculations are combined with a wallmodel based on the law-of-the-wall and in DES a hybrid RANS/LES method is used forhandling the near wall region. READ MORE

  2. 2. Deformations and stresses in butt-welding of plates : numerical simulation and experimental verification

    Author : Lars-Erik Lindgren; Luleå tekniska universitet;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; Material Mechanics; Materialmekanik;

    Abstract : Deformation and stresses in butt-welding of plates were studied. The work includes numerical simulation and experimental verification. The simulations were performed by use of the finite element method. Temperature dependence of material properties and phase transformations were considered. READ MORE

  5. 5. Numerical simulation of shape rolling

    Author : Stanislav Riljak; Stefan Jonsson; Peter Gudmundson; KTH;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; shape rolling; wire-rod rolling; finite-element method; generalized plane-strain; dislocation density; material model; Other materials science; Övrig teknisk materialvetenskap;

    Abstract : In the first part of this thesis, the FE program MSC.Marc is applied for coupled thermomechanical simulations of wire-rod rolling. In order to predict material behaviour of an AISI 302 stainless steel at high strain rates generated during wire-rod rolling, a material model based on dislocation density is applied. READ MORE
